Prince Andrew has been stripped of his honorary 'freedom of York' title following a brutal unanimous vote by York City Council.
Councillors voted for the removal in an Extraordinary Council Meeting on Wednesday in the latest blow for the disgraced Duke.
It comes after Prince Andrew reached an out of court settlement with his accuser, Virginia Giuffre, in a civil sex claim filed in the US.The prince managed to avoid trial with the settlement which is said to be £12million.
Andrew has vehemently denied all allegations.Many councillors said the removal of his Honorary Freedom of the City of York was just a starting point for the changes that should be made.Councillor Gwen Swinburn slammed Prince Andrew as a "disgrace" who brought "shame and repetitional damage everywhere he goes, including to our city"."He needs to be declared persona non grata in York," she said.Rachael Maskell, a Labour MP who represents York Central, said Andrew must remove his association with the city.
